Canada tends to be a bit of a role model to Australia when it comes to indigenous issues – yesterday at a meeting in Canberra the issue was how to stop indigenous prisoners getting out of gaol and then ending up back inside a short time later. The meeting heard from the Native Counselling Services of Alberta about a program they’ve introduced which is making a real difference. Mick Gooda from the Cooperative Research Centre for Aboriginal Health says the Canadian program works froma cultural base and he’s hoping to get similar programs working in Australian prisons.
